The US Air Force has awarded a contract to Dynamics Research Corporation to provide technical support at the F-16 programme office.

Under the $13.9m contract the company will provide programme management and technical services to assist with the modernisation and maintenance of the F-16 weapon system.

The F-16 is a technologically advanced fourth-generation fighter aircraft that can detect and track time-critical hard-to-find targets in all weather conditions.

Additional capabilities of the fighter also include in-flight data sharing with coalition forces, air-borne mission role change capability, expanded defence options against lethal threats and reduced operational costs.

The three-year contract is part of the logistics, maintenance and supply contract supporting the F-16 programme office at the Aeronautical Systems Center Wright Patterson Air Force Base, Ohio.
